SoulAlive said:

In 1983,Luther produced an album for Dionne Warwick and "So Amazing" is one of the tracks that he gave her....

I read Luther and Dionne wanted this released as a single but that crazy mofo Clive Davis didn't think it had hit potential. loser Was it a single in Europe? 'Cause I've seen international pressings of the 'How Many Times...' LP and it's titled 'So Amazing'.
